Never forget: In 2014, the cost of hosting #Europvision in Copenhagen spiraled out of control, ending up costing 15 million EUR, instead of the budgeted 4.5 million EUR.

The official inquiry report, trying to explain how it was possible to blow the budget by 220%, included this gem as its first chart. Headline "project complexity", and the Y-axis is "challenges".
